Ariados
It wanders in search of food after darkness falls, never nesting in a specific place.
| Supertype |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Stage 1 |
| HP | 90 |
| Types | Grass |
| Attack | String Bind |
| Attack cost | Grass |
| Artist | Anesaki Dynamic |
| Rarity | Uncommon |
| Pokédex | 168 |
| Evolves from | Spinarak |
